    What to do if my High End Systems Flood Light lamp shuts off during operation?
    • R
      Randall GillAug 12, 2025
      If the lamp shuts off during operation, it could be due to a bad lamp, in which case you should replace it. Alternatively, the fixture may have exceeded its maximum temperature; allow 5 to 10 minutes for it to cool, then try turning the lamp on again.

    Why is my High End Systems Flood Light lighting controller not recognizing a fixture at the assigned address?
    • D
      dukeshaneAug 16, 2025
      The lighting controller might not recognize a fixture because the lighting desk was configured with a fixture at that address, but no fixtures were found there. If there is a fixture at that address, verify the fixture number or DMX start channel. Check connections and ensure the fixture is turned on. Another potential cause is that controllers, serial data distributors, data line optoisolators, or fixtures using RS-422 communication are connected before the Studio Command fixtures on the link; remove or bypass these devices or move them after the Studio Command fixtures.

    Why are not all High End Systems Studio Command Flood Light fixtures on the link receiving the upload?
    • D
      Denise BensonAug 20, 2025
      If not all fixtures on the link are receiving the upload, the fixtures might be off, so power them on. Also, there might be bad cables, so test and replace cables as necessary. Another reason might be that the cables are disconnected, so reconnect them. It might also be that controllers, serial data distributors, data line Optoisolators, or fixtures using RS-422 communication are connected before Studio Command fixtures on the link, so remove or bypass any incompatible devices from the data link or move them to a link position after the Studio Command fixtures.

    Why is my High End Systems Studio Command fixture functioning, but the lamp won't strike?
    • S
      Susan JohnsonSep 2, 2025
      If the fixture functions but the lamp does not strike, the lamp might be bad, so replace it. If you have the 700 model, the lamp may be currently too hot to strike; provide the correct power source voltage, power cord cap, and input voltage setting, allow the lamp to cool, then restrike the lamp.
